摘要
Bi(12)TiO(20) crystals with sillenite structures were prepared by a chemical solution decomposition (CSD) method. The band gap of Bi(12)TiO(20) crystals was estimated to be about 2.4 eV from the onset of UV-Vis absorption spectra of the photocatalyst. The energy band of Bi(12)TiO(20) is assumed to between the top of Bi(3+) 6s band and the bottom of the Ti 3d band. The photocatalyst based on Bi(12)TiO(20) crystals for photo-decolorization of methyl orange had been examined first. Bi(12)TiO(20) crystals show high photocatalystic activity to photo-decolorization 10 ppm methyl orange solution in 1.5 h. Bi-O polyhedra in Bi(12)TiO(20) crystals were assumed to facilitate the photocatalystic activity of the catalysts. (C) 2002 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
